To the Islamic State of Iraq and Syria, Syrian women are slaves. To much of the rest of the world, they are victims.It's time we expose their real identity: an untapped resource for creating lasting peace. Listening to and implementing the ideas of women still living in Syria is key to weakening ISIS and stabilizing the region at large because, in many ways, they have a better track record laying the foundations for peace and democracy than any other group.Over the last two years, we've worked side-by-side with Syrian women leaders as they propose concrete steps to end the war.
